Prep and Cook Time

Preparation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: ⁢7 minutes
Total Time: 22 minutes

Yield

Serves 4 as a light meal⁣ or side ⁤dish

Difficulty Level

Easy – Perfect for beginners and seasoned cooks alike

Ingredients

  • 200g soba noodles (100% buckwheat for authentic flavor)
  • 1 medium cucumber, julienned
  • 1 large⁢ carrot, peeled and ‍shredded
  • 1/2 cup edamame, ⁣shelled and cooked
  • 2 spring onions,⁢ th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up fresh‍ cilantro, roughly chopped
  • 1 tbsp toasted ​sesame seeds
  • 1 tbsp toasted nori flakes (optional)
  • For the ⁣Dressing:
  • 3 ​tbsp soy sauce (low sodium ​preferred)
  • 2​ tbsp rice vinegar
  • 1 tbsp toasted sesame oil
  • 1 ⁢tbsp honey or maple‌ syrup
  • 1 tsp⁤ grated fresh ginger
  • 1 small garlic clove,​ minced
  • 1/2 tsp chili​ flakes (optional)

instructions

  1. Cook⁣ the soba noodles ⁣according to package directions, usually 5-7 minutes in rapidly boiling water. Stir occasionally to keep noodles separate.Drain and rinse ⁢under cold water⁢ to⁣ halt cooking and cool the⁢ noodles entirely-this also removes excess starch.
  2. Prepare your⁢ vegetables while the noodles‍ cool. Julienne the ‍cucumber, shred the carrot, slice the spring onions, and roughly chop the cilantro. Blanch ⁢edamame if frozen, then drain.
  3. Make the dressing: Whisk together soy sauce, rice‍ vinegar, toasted sesame oil, honey, grated ginger,⁤ minced​ garlic, and chili flakes until well combined. Taste‌ and adjust sweetness or acidity as desired.
  4. Assemble the salad: In ⁤a large bowl,combine soba noodles,cucumber,carrot,edamame,spring onions,and ⁣cilantro. Pour the dressing over and toss gently but thoroughly to coat every strand and vegetable piece.
  5. Allow flavors to ⁢meld: Let⁤ the⁢ salad rest‌ for at least 10 minutes at room temperature, or refrigerate for up to an hour.This step deepens ⁤the savory-sweet balance and softens the noodles slightly without​ losing texture.
  6. Finish and serve: Just before serving, sprinkle⁢ toasted sesame seeds‌ and nori flakes ⁣to introduce⁢ a rich, ⁣nutty ‍crunch and‍ umami spark.

Chef’s Notes: Tips for Success

  • Choosing the freshest ⁢ingredients ⁣ is key-look for firm cucumbers without blemishes and luminous, ⁤crisp carrots.⁢ Fresh herbs like cilantro bring a lively ‌green note that enlivens the ⁣whole dish.
  • Soba noodles ‌vary in quality and‍ flavor: 100% buckwheat ​will offer the most authentic taste, but blends⁤ are easier to find and still tasty. Make sure to rinse noodles thoroughly to avoid clumping.
  • Dressing variations: ‍ Swap honey with agave or⁤ maple​ syrup​ for vegan needs,or add a splash of ​lime​ juice⁣ for citrus brightness.
  • Make ahead: Prepare soba noodles and dressing separately and ​toss​ together just before serving to ​preserve freshness and texture.
  • Storing: Store leftovers in an airtight container in ‌the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Toss again before serving as ‌dressing may settle‌ or be absorbed.

Q1: What makes soba noodles an excellent base for a refreshing salad?
A1: Soba noodles, made​ from buckwheat, bring a ⁣nutty, earthy flavor and ‌a satisfyingly firm texture that hold ⁢up beautifully in cold dishes.Their natural goodness pairs seamlessly with crisp vegetables⁤ and bright⁢ dressings, making ‍them a revitalizing and wholesome canvas for a salad.

Q2: How do you achieve the “perfect harmony” of flavors ⁣in a soba noodle salad?

A2: ⁢harmony comes from balancing contrasting yet complementary⁢ elements:‍ the subtle nuttiness ‌of​ the noodles, the tangy zing​ of rice vinegar or citrus in the dressing, the gentle heat of ginger ⁣or chili, the ⁢umami depth of soy sauce, and the fresh​ crunch of garden veggies. A sprinkle of toasted sesame seeds⁢ or fresh herbs ties the whole ensemble together.

Q3: What are some key ingredients to include for flavor and texture ⁤contrast?
A3: Think vibrant: julienned carrots, crisp cucumbers,⁤ thinly sliced ⁤bell⁣ peppers, and snap peas add a refreshing ‌crunch. Shredded cabbage or scallions lend a bite, while edamame or tofu contribute protein and a creamy contrast. Fresh herbs like cilantro or mint inject ⁤a fragrant brightness.

Q4:⁤ Can soba noodle salad be customized for different dietary preferences?
A4: Absolutely!⁢ It’s naturally gluten-free if you choose 100% buckwheat soba (always check⁣ packaging). The ​salad is​ a breeze to veganize by opting for tamari instead⁤ of soy sauce and incorporating tofu or ⁢tempeh.⁤ For a pescatarian ⁣twist, add grilled shrimp ​or seared salmon.

Q5: How should soba noodles⁢ be prepared for a‌ salad to ensure the best texture?
A5: Cook⁢ the noodles al dente following package instructions, then drain ⁣and rinse thoroughly under cold water. This stops cooking and cools‌ the noodles ⁤to prevent ‍sogginess, keeping them springy⁢ and ​ready to soak⁤ up⁢ the vibrant dressing without getting mushy.
